– Comparison of common materials (e.g., steel, aluminum, titanium)
When choosing a tactical keychain for everyday carry defense, the materials used play a significant role in its effectiveness and durability. Common options include steel, aluminum, and titanium, each with unique properties. Steel, known for its strength and toughness, offers superior edge retention and impact resistance, making it ideal for self-defense scenarios. However, it may be heavier and require more maintenance compared to other materials.
Aluminum keychains are lightweight yet robust, offering excellent corrosion resistance and a good balance between strength and weight. Titanium is another popular choice, renowned for its exceptional durability and low density, making it perfect for those seeking a stealthy option. In terms of impact-resistant keychain weapons, titanium stands out due to its superior strength-to-weight ratio, ensuring reliable performance even in harsh conditions.
